Abstract

This work proposes a variation of the location-routing problem (LRP), a problem that interconnects two well-known N P-hard optimisation problems: the vehicle routing problem (VRP) and facility location problem (FLP). There are many mathematical formulations and solution methods for a number of variations already within the literature. However, the inclusion of both already existing and new intermediate facilities within a static model makes this work unique. As a business expands, there will be a need for the business to add to its distribution network. Considering both new and existing intermediate facilities within the model will allow a business to use their current distribution network and grow it efficiently. In this work we propose selection hyper-heuristic methods for our LRP, considering choosing low-level heuristics based on their performance and constructing sequences of them.
